Water Softener Installation in Houston, TX

Water softener installation services involve setting up systems designed to reduce mineral content such as calcium and magnesium in household water supplies. These systems help prevent scale buildup in plumbing, appliances, and fixtures, improving water quality and extending the lifespan of appliances like dishwashers and water heaters. Projects typically include installing new water softeners in homes experiencing hard water issues or replacing outdated units, ensuring that property owners have access to softer, more manageable water throughout their residence.

Homeowners considering water softener installation usually want to understand the compatibility of different system types with their property’s plumbing, as well as the maintenance requirements and operational costs involved. It’s also common to inquire about the size and capacity of the system needed for their household, based on water usage and hardness levels. Proper installation ensures optimal performance and helps property owners enjoy the benefits of softer water with minimal disruption to daily routines.

Project Types

Common Water Softener Installation Jobs

Water Softener Installation - professional setup to improve water quality and protect plumbing.

Whole-House Water Softener - system installed to treat water for the entire property.

Point-of-Use Water Softener - targeted installation for specific appliances or fixtures.

Salt-Based Water Softener - traditional systems that use salt to reduce mineral buildup.

Salt-Free Water Softener - alternative systems that condition water without salt for maintenance ease.

Replacement and Upgrades - upgrading existing systems for better performance and efficiency.

FAQ

Water Softener Installation Questions

What is a water softener? A water softener is a device that removes minerals like calcium and magnesium from hard water, helping to prevent buildup and improve water quality.

How does water softener installation work? The installation involves connecting the unit to the home's plumbing system, typically near the main water line, to treat incoming water.

What are common signs that a water softener is needed? Signs include scale buildup on fixtures, soap not lathering well, and noticing soap scum or dry skin after showers.

Can a water softener be installed in any home? Many homes with hard water can benefit from installation, especially those with noticeable mineral buildup or plumbing issues.
